Mid-Wheel vs Front-Wheel vs Rear-Wheel Drive Powerchairs: What's the Difference?

When choosing a powered wheelchair, one specification that can have a major influence on how the chair feels to use is the position of its drive wheels.

Powered wheelchairs are commonly available with mid-wheel, front-wheel or rear-wheel drive. Each configuration behaves differently when turning, manoeuvring indoors and travelling outdoors, which means the best option depends heavily on where and how the wheelchair will be used.

For somebody buying their first powerchair, the terminology can make the choice seem more complicated than it needs to be. The important thing is not deciding that one drive system is universally "best", but understanding which characteristics are most useful for your own mobility and everyday environment.

What Does Powered Wheelchair Drive Type Mean?

The drive type describes where the wheelchair's main powered wheels are positioned in relation to the user.

The three principal configurations are:

  • Mid-wheel drive - powered wheels positioned around the middle of the wheelchair
  • Front-wheel drive - powered wheels positioned towards the front
  • Rear-wheel drive - powered wheels positioned towards the back

The remaining wheels help provide stability, but the position of the main drive wheels affects how the wheelchair pivots and responds to steering.

This can change the way a chair feels when navigating a narrow hallway, positioning alongside furniture, turning through a doorway or travelling along an outdoor path.

What Is a Mid-Wheel Drive Powerchair?

A mid-wheel drive powered wheelchair positions the main drive wheels close to the centre of the chair.

One of the major advantages of this design is manoeuvrability. Because the chair pivots close to the user's position, mid-wheel drive models can offer a tight and intuitive turning action.

This can make them particularly useful for people who need to navigate restricted indoor environments.

Mid-wheel drive can be worth considering if you regularly need to manoeuvre through:

  • Narrow hallways
  • Doorways
  • Bedrooms
  • Kitchens
  • Shops
  • Workplaces
  • Other restricted indoor areas

Advantages of Mid-Wheel Drive

The main attraction of mid-wheel drive is often its turning behaviour.

With the pivot point close to the user, many people find it easier to judge where the chair will move during a turn. This can be particularly helpful when positioning at a table, approaching furniture or navigating confined areas.

Potential advantages include:

  • Tight turning capability
  • Good indoor manoeuvrability
  • Intuitive positioning for many users
  • Suitable options for combined indoor and outdoor use
  • Availability of advanced seating systems on some models

However, the actual performance depends on the individual model, dimensions, suspension and setup. Drive position alone should never be used to judge an entire wheelchair.

What Is a Front-Wheel Drive Powerchair?

A front-wheel drive powerchair places the main powered wheels towards the front of the wheelchair, with the rear of the chair following behind during a turn.

This gives the wheelchair different handling characteristics from a mid-wheel drive model.

Front-wheel drive can provide useful traction and obstacle-handling characteristics, making it an option worth considering for users who combine indoor mobility with regular outdoor journeys.

Because the chair pivots from further forward, the rear of the wheelchair can swing out as the chair turns. This behaviour may take some familiarisation, particularly when navigating tight indoor environments.

Advantages of Front-Wheel Drive

Depending on the particular wheelchair, front-wheel drive can provide:

  • Good traction
  • Confident outdoor performance
  • Useful obstacle-handling characteristics
  • Good positioning when approaching some surfaces or furniture
  • A driving style preferred by some experienced powerchair users

The larger rearward movement during turns means that understanding the chair's dimensions and turning behaviour is particularly important where indoor space is restricted.

What Is a Rear-Wheel Drive Powerchair?

A rear-wheel drive powered wheelchair positions the main drive wheels towards the back of the chair.

This is a traditional powered wheelchair configuration and can provide predictable directional handling, particularly when travelling forwards over longer distances.

Rear-wheel drive models can appeal to people who spend significant amounts of time travelling outdoors and value stable, confident forward movement.

The position of the drive wheels means that the front of the wheelchair follows a wider path during turns than it would on many mid-wheel drive chairs. This can make the turning space required indoors an important consideration.

Advantages of Rear-Wheel Drive

Depending on the model and intended use, potential advantages can include:

  • Predictable forward handling
  • Good directional stability
  • Suitability for regular outdoor journeys
  • Confident handling over longer distances
  • A familiar driving style for experienced rear-wheel drive users

As with every configuration, these characteristics need to be considered alongside the wheelchair's suspension, seating, dimensions and intended environment.

Which Powerchair Is Best for Indoor Use?

If indoor manoeuvrability is a major priority, mid-wheel drive is often one of the first configurations worth considering.

The ability to turn around a central point can be extremely useful in homes where space is restricted.

However, the drive configuration is not the only factor that determines whether a wheelchair will work indoors.

You also need to consider:

  • Overall chair width
  • Overall length
  • Actual turning circle
  • Footplate position
  • Doorway width
  • Hallway dimensions
  • Furniture layout

A compact front or rear-wheel drive chair may work better in a particular property than a larger mid-wheel model, so actual dimensions matter.

Which Powerchair Is Best for Outdoor Use?

Outdoor performance is more complicated because drive position is only one part of the wheelchair's design.

Regular outdoor users should also consider:

  • Suspension
  • Tyres
  • Ground clearance
  • Battery capacity
  • Motor performance
  • Stability
  • Maximum recommended gradients
  • The surfaces the chair is designed to handle

Front and rear-wheel drive models can provide useful characteristics for outdoor mobility, while many modern mid-wheel powerchairs are also designed to provide capable outdoor performance.

Think About Your Actual Outdoor Journeys

The term "outdoor use" covers an enormous range of situations.

Somebody travelling from home to nearby shops on relatively level pavements has very different requirements from someone regularly travelling across uneven paths, steep slopes or rural surfaces.

Think about:

  • Typical journey distance
  • Pavement condition
  • Dropped kerbs
  • Slopes and hills
  • Grass or gravel
  • Busy pedestrian areas
  • Whether the chair also needs to work indoors

These practical details are often much more useful during an assessment than simply saying you want an "outdoor powerchair".

Which Drive Type Has the Smallest Turning Circle?

Mid-wheel drive powerchairs are particularly associated with tight turning capability because of the position of their central drive wheels.

This can make them attractive for homes, shops and other environments where frequent direction changes are necessary.

But turning circle figures should still be compared between individual models.

Wheelchair dimensions vary, and factors such as footplates and seating configuration can influence the space required in real-world use.

Does Drive Type Affect Seating?

Drive configuration and seating are separate considerations, but both need to work together.

Powered wheelchairs can range from relatively straightforward chairs to highly configurable models offering specialist seating and powered positioning functions.

Depending on individual requirements, these may include:

  • Adjustable seating
  • Specialist back support
  • Pressure management
  • Powered tilt
  • Powered recline
  • Powered seat elevation
  • Elevating leg supports

If somebody spends substantial periods in their powered wheelchair, seating requirements may be more important than choosing between two drive configurations with relatively small handling differences.

Consider Joystick Position and Control

The way a wheelchair responds to the joystick is another important part of how it feels to drive.

Joystick positioning should allow the user to operate the chair comfortably and accurately.

Depending on the wheelchair and control system, driving characteristics may also be configured to provide an appropriate response for the individual user.

This is particularly important for somebody moving from a manual wheelchair or mobility scooter to a powerchair for the first time.

What About Transporting the Powerchair?

Drive type should not distract from another major consideration: how the wheelchair will be transported.

Powered wheelchairs contain motors, batteries and electrical systems and can therefore be substantially heavier than manual wheelchairs.

Before choosing a chair, consider:

  • Whether it needs to travel in a car
  • Available boot or vehicle space
  • Whether a ramp or hoist is required
  • Whether the chair is intended to be occupied during vehicle transport
  • How frequently it will be transported

If easy car transport is one of your main priorities, a larger configurable powerchair may not be the most practical solution regardless of drive configuration.

Mid-Wheel, Front-Wheel or Rear-Wheel: Which Should You Choose?

Consider Mid-Wheel Drive If:

  • Indoor manoeuvrability is particularly important
  • You regularly navigate tight spaces
  • You prefer a chair that pivots close to your position
  • You need a combination of indoor and outdoor mobility

Consider Front-Wheel Drive If:

  • You value the handling characteristics of a front-driven chair
  • Outdoor traction and obstacle handling are important
  • Your normal environment provides sufficient space for its turning behaviour
  • You prefer the way a front-wheel drive model feels during assessment

Consider Rear-Wheel Drive If:

  • You regularly make longer outdoor journeys
  • You value predictable forward handling
  • You are comfortable with the turning characteristics
  • Your home and normal environments provide adequate manoeuvring space

These are useful starting points rather than strict rules. Individual wheelchair models can behave very differently even when they use the same basic drive configuration.

Why Trying a Powered Wheelchair Matters

Specifications can tell you the dimensions, drive configuration and theoretical turning circle of a wheelchair. They cannot tell you how confident you will feel controlling it.

Someone accustomed to rear-wheel drive may initially find a mid-wheel chair very different, while another user may immediately prefer the way it pivots.

Trying an appropriate chair also allows practical issues to become apparent, including:

  • Joystick reach
  • Seating comfort
  • Turning behaviour
  • Doorway access
  • Positioning alongside furniture
  • Outdoor control

This is why a powered wheelchair assessment is considerably more useful than choosing from specifications alone.

Frequently Asked Questions

What are the three main types of powered wheelchair drive?

The three principal configurations are mid-wheel, front-wheel and rear-wheel drive. The name describes where the main powered wheels are positioned on the wheelchair.

Which powered wheelchair has the best turning circle?

Mid-wheel drive powerchairs are particularly associated with tight turning capability because they pivot close to the centre of the chair. Actual turning circles vary between individual models.

Is mid-wheel drive better indoors?

Mid-wheel drive can be an excellent option where indoor manoeuvrability is important, but the wheelchair's overall dimensions and the available space also need to be considered.

Which powerchair drive type is best outdoors?

There is no single best drive configuration for every outdoor user. Suspension, tyres, ground clearance, battery capacity, stability and the terrain involved are also important.

Is rear-wheel drive good for outdoor journeys?

Rear-wheel drive powerchairs can provide predictable forward handling and are available in models designed for regular outdoor mobility. Suitability depends on the individual wheelchair and intended terrain.

What is the advantage of front-wheel drive?

Front-wheel drive can offer useful traction and obstacle-handling characteristics. Its turning behaviour differs from mid-wheel drive because the rear of the chair follows around during a turn.

Can a mid-wheel drive powerchair be used outside?

Yes. Many modern mid-wheel drive powered wheelchairs are designed for combined indoor and outdoor use. Outdoor capability varies considerably by model.

Does drive type affect wheelchair comfort?

Drive configuration affects handling, but seating configuration, suspension and postural support can have a greater influence on comfort. These factors should be assessed together.
